Loomer’s India Trip Backfires
- Laura Loomer traveled to the India Today conclave with her fiancé and posted Taj Mahal photos as a paid junket/preview trip.
- She faced hosts who confronted her past anti-Indian tweets and attempted deletions, turning the visit into public humiliation.
Loomer Claims Close Contact With Trump
- Loomer claimed frequent contact with Donald Trump, saying she spoke to him three times in the past week and once an hour before her stage appearance.
- Will and Sam point out this fits a pattern of the administration taking calls from fringe figures and an open phone line to Trump.
Loomer Positions Herself For White House Role
- Loomer framed herself as a prospective White House press secretary and said she's investigating 'a lot of people in the administration' for sympathies to radical Islam.
- Sam notes this shows her ambition and how fringe figures position themselves for official roles.
